How Our Ceiling Water Damage Repair Service Works
At our company, we understand the importance of a proper process with ceiling water damage repair. Our team follows a step-by-step approach to ensure your property is restored to its original condition, including:
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our technicians will visually inspect your ceiling and surrounding areas to find out the extent of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ect any hidden water damage or potential safety hazards.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uum equipment to extract as much water as possible from your ceiling and surrounding areas.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will set up indust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out your ceiling and surrounding areas, reducing the risk of mold growth and further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We’ll clean and disinfect all aff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Our team will repair or replace any damaged ceiling tiles, drywall, or other materials to ensure your property is restored to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Damage Repair
Ignoring water damage can lead to costly repairs, safety hazards, and even health risks. Keep an eye out for these warning signs and call a professional for help: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ore it – call a professional to investigate and repair the issue.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leaky roof or pipe. Address the problem quickly to prevent further damage and safety hazards.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Call a professional to inspect and repair the issue before it gets worse.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Mold growth can be a sign of water damage or poor ventilation. Don’t ignore it – call a professional to inspect and remediate the issue.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Call a professional to inspect and repair the issue before it gets worse.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ks in your 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. Don’t ignore it – call a professional to investigate and repair the issue.

Ceiling Water Damage Repair Cost in Eagle, WI
The cost of ceiling water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Eagle, WI.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and type of materials involved |
| Repair or replacement of damaged materials |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ials involved, and labor costs |
| Mold remediation |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and equipment needed |
| Structural repairs |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and labor costs |
| Dehumidification and equipment rental |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ed |
